Kinds Of UK Driving Licenses
The Uk Driving License Consultant provides various categories of driving licenses based upon the kind of car that people want to operate. Comprehending these categories is necessary for both brand-new drivers and those seeking to upgrade their existing licenses. The main types include:

Full Driving License: This is the most common kind of license, enabling people to drive cars and trucks and other motor lorries.

Provisional Driving License: This is issued to new drivers who have applied to take their driving test. It permits students to drive under specific conditions (e.g., accompanied by a certified driver) while they prepare for their driving test.

Motorbike License: This allows people to run motorcycles. The bike license can even more be subdivided into:
AM: Moped licenseA1: Light motorbike licenseA2: Medium bike licenseA: Full motorcycle license for larger motorbikes
Commercial Driving License: For those who mean to drive industrial cars, such as buses or heavy products automobiles (HGVs). These licenses need extra endorsements and training.

Driving License for Special Vehicles: This includes licenses for specific car types like tractors or particular kinds of farming equipment.
Requirements for Obtaining a UK Driving License1. Age Requirement
To request a provisionary driving license in the UK, an individual need to be at least 17 years old. However, one can make an application for a license at 16 if meaning to drive a moped.
2. Residency and Identification
Applicants must be homeowners of the UK and supply identification. Appropriate kinds of ID consist of:
PassportBirth certificateNational Identity Card3. Medical Fitness
Candidates need to declare if they experience any medical conditions that might affect their capability to drive. Some conditions require a medical exam or alert to the Driver and Vehicle Licensing Agency (DVLA).
4. Passing the Theory Test
Before obtaining a practical driving test, candidates must pass a theory test. This test examines understanding of the Highway Code, road indications, and safe driving practices. It consists of:
A multiple-choice sectionA threat perception test5. Practical Driving Test
Once the theory test is passed, candidates can schedule a useful driving test. This assessment assesses an individual's driving skills behind the wheel and ensures they can run a vehicle safely in various conditions.
6. Application Process
Finally, people must complete a driving license application and pay the suitable charge. This form can be finished online or through paper applications readily available at post workplaces.

Can I drive in other nations with a UK driving license?
Yes, a UK driving license is generally recognized in lots of nations worldwide. However, it is a good idea to inspect the requirements for the specific country, as some may need an International Driving Permit (IDP) in addition to the UK license.
4. What should I do if I lose my driving license?
If a driving license is lost, the individual ought to report it to the DVLA as soon as possible and apply for a replacement license online or by sending a paper kind. This generally requires a fee.
5. Can I drive if I have a medical condition?
Lots of medical conditions can impact an individual's ability to drive. It is essential to notify the DVLA about any medical diagnosis that might hinder safe driving. The DVLA will evaluate each case on an individual basis, and driving might be restricted or momentarily prohibited up until medical fitness is verified.
